Schedule Planner (Main Dashboard) – Table Structure and Columns

This is the central hub of the Operations Dashboard, where daily, weekly, or monthly schedules are visualized.

  • Column A: Date (Date Type) – Format as "dd/mm/yyyy" for consistency.
  • Column B: Shift Type (Text/Validation List) – Options: Morning (8AM–4PM), Afternoon (12PM–8PM), Night (8PM–4AM), Overtime, Break.
  • Column C: Department/Team – Dropdown list with departments: Production, Logistics, HR, IT Support, Customer Service.
  • Column D: Assigned Staff (Text) – Enter staff names; supports lookup from Resource Calendar.
  • Column E: Task Description (Text) – e.g., "Machine Maintenance", "Client Onboarding", "Inventory Audit".
  • Column F: Start Time (Time Type) – Format as "13:30" for consistency.
  • Column G: End Time (Time Type)
  • Column H: Duration (Formula – Duration in Hours) – =IF(G2="", "", (G2 - F2)*24) to calculate hours.
  • Column I: Priority Level (Dropdown) – High, Medium, Low. Used for conditional formatting and reporting.
  • Column J: Status (Dropdown) – Not Started, In Progress, Completed, Delayed. Drives dashboard visuals.

KPIs & Performance Metrics Dashboard

A summary view for executives and operations leads. Key formulas include:

  • Total Assigned Tasks: =COUNTA(SchedulePlanner!E:E) - 1 (excluding header)
  • On-Time Completion Rate: =COUNTIF(SchedulePlanner!J:J, "Completed") / COUNTA(SchedulePlanner!J:J) * 100
  • Average Duration per Task: =AVERAGEIF(SchedulePlanner!I:I, "<>", SchedulePlanner!H:H)
  • Resource Utilization %: =COUNTIF(ResourceCalendar!C:C, "Assigned") / (COUNTA(ResourceCalendar!C:C) - 1) * 100

Conditional Formatting Rules

To enhance readability and alert users to critical conditions:

  • Past Due Tasks: If Due Date < TODAY(), highlight red.
  • High Priority Tasks: Text in yellow background with black bold font.
  • Status Column (J): Green for "Completed", Yellow for "In Progress", Red for "Delayed".
  • Duplicate Assignments: Highlight if same staff is assigned to two tasks within overlapping time slots.
  • Over 8-Hour Shifts: If Duration > 8, highlight in orange.

User Instructions for Best Usage:

  1. Begin by populating the Resource Calendar with all team members and their weekly availability.
  2. Select tasks from the Task Tracker and assign them using the Schedule Planner sheet.
  3. Use Data Validation (dropdowns) to maintain consistency across columns.
  4. Set up conditional formatting for immediate visual cues on priorities and delays.
  5. Update KPIs weekly—auto-calculations ensure accuracy without manual math errors.
  6. To avoid double-booking, cross-check the Resource Calendar when assigning staff.
